Output 43f3c4399e52d8b6e9846da4cce33fc45bc36156f285cf7ac151ece1d802f4f4:1

value
6971201714749
script pubkey
OP_0 OP_PUSHBYTES_20 cfd27492a3e067e0357640279d3747f4aabe85ae
address
tb1qelf8fy4rupn7qdtkgqne6d687j4tapdwzv47w5
transaction
43f3c4399e52d8b6e9846da4cce33fc45bc36156f285cf7ac151ece1d802f4f4
confirmations
190125
spent
true